Measurements
Proper helmet fit is vital to the performance of a helmet during an impact. For maximum protection the helmet must fit properly with the chin strap securely fastened and provide adequate peripheral vision.
Measuring the head is only a starting point for the entire sizing procedure. Due to varying shapes, heads that are apparently the same size when measured by a tape may not necessarily fit the same size helmet.
A small metal tape measure or a cloth tape may be used to make your initial measurement. You can also use a string, which can then be laid against a measuring tape.
The circumference of the head should be measured at a point approximately one inch above the eyebrows in front, and at a point in the back of the head that results in the largest possible measurement. Take several measurements. The largest measurement is the one you want to try on first. If you use a balaclava or head sock, always measure and fit the helmet with it on. Use the Bell sizing chart to determine the size that best matches the head measurement.

Description
The HP6 incorporates technology from Bell's state-of-the-art HP7 Advanced Helmets, offering a modern and aggressive design specifically developed for racers in closed-car environments. Featuring a wide eyeport for extended vision and an ultra-lightweight advanced carbon shell, this helmet ensures both comfort and high performance for professional motorsport drivers.
Equipped with ventilation slots compatible with various external cooling systems, the HP6 can be fitted with optional earcups for optimal noise insulation. It also supports a fully integrated radio communication kit and hydration systems, available separately or included in the RD version. Designed for high-speed closed-car racing, the HP6 combines advanced technology, comfort, and safety in one premium package.
